GS7B011022DCT Description

GS7B011022DCT Description

The GS7B011022DCT from TT Electronics/IRC is a high-precision ceramic resistor network designed for demanding electronic applications. This 14-pin narrow SOIC device features 13 bussed resistors with a 10.2KΩ resistance value and an absolute tolerance of ±0.5%, ensuring exceptional accuracy. Built with thin-film technology, it offers a temperature coefficient of ±100ppm/°C, maintaining stable performance across a wide temperature range of -55°C to +125°C. The SOIC package (8.66mm x 5.99mm x 1.45mm) with gull-wing terminations ensures reliable surface-mount assembly, while its 0.7W total power rating (0.05W per resistor) suits compact, power-sensitive designs.

GS7B011022DCT Features

  • High Precision: ±0.5% tolerance and ±0.25% ratio tolerance for critical analog/digital circuits.
  • Robust Construction: Ceramic case and thin-film technology enhance durability and thermal stability.
  • Space-Efficient: 14-pin SOIC package optimizes PCB real estate in dense layouts.
  • Wide Voltage Range: Supports up to 100V, ideal for industrial and automotive (non-AECQ) applications.
  • Low TCR: ±100ppm/°C ensures minimal resistance drift under temperature fluctuations.
  • Automation-Friendly: Gull-wing terminals and 1.27mm pitch simplify pick-and-place assembly.
